Litre per hour (L/h) is a unit of volumetric flow rate commonly used to measure the flow of liquids, especially in contexts like automotive fuel consumption, industrial processes, and even water filtration systems. It’s quite fascinating to consider that this seemingly straightforward unit plays a pivotal role in optimizing fuel efficiency and managing resource consumption. For instance, in automobiles, understanding L/h helps in gauging engine efficiency, thereby shaping innovations aimed at reducing emissions and increasing sustainability.
Interestingly, L/h is also vital in everyday scenarios such as aquariums or home brewing, where maintaining a consistent and precise flow rate is essential for the successful nurturing of aquatic life or achieving the perfect brew. This level of accuracy and consistency can make all the difference, showcasing the critical role of L/h in diverse fields.
Cubic meter per hour (m³/h) might seem like just a simple metric unit of flow rate, but it plays a crucial role in various industries, especially in water supply and waste management systems. Understanding this unit can help imagine vast quantities efficiently: one cubic meter equals 1,000 liters, so just one m³/h represents the flow of 1,000 liters in an hour. This means that a single household’s daily water usage could often be entirely represented within a few cubic meters per hour.
Moreover, m³/h is extensively used in HVAC systems where air supply and exhaust rates are critical for maintaining breathable environments in buildings. In industries like oil and gas, it helps to determine the rate of fluid transfer, enhancing accurate forecasting and resource management. This universal metric enables seamless communication and coordination across global projects, underscoring its importance in engineering and environmental monitoring.
